Coachella is Coming to Paris

Right now, on social media, the #fetedelamusique2025 has already racked up over 70 million views. This incredible feat is thanks to a strange fascination that’s developed across the globe for this event this year. And if the p... touches the whole world, it’s our British neighbors who seem the most motivated to make the trip to the capital for the occasion. On TikTok, you can indeed see quite a few people lamenting the fully booked Eurostar on the 21st, the overpriced Airbnbs, or simply a group of young people practicing how to say the phrase « Wesh, ça dit quoi ? ».

It clearly appears that some people, like this English woman who packed more than 15 outfits for 3 days, are mistaking this musical and family celebration for some sort of French Coachella. Just to remind you, Coachella is a huge California festival that is often confused with a fashion show, where people go more to showcase their presence on Insta than to actually listen to music.
